Overview Microsoft Hardware and Infrastructure Fundamentals Engineering (HIFE) is the team that owns and delivers on all aspects related to Cloud Manufacturing for Microsoft’s Azure Cloud. The organization is responsible from end to end manufacturing quality and infrastructure – which means supporting and resolving issues for incoming hardware, deployment and sustenance of the fleet. Our focus is on smart growth, high efficiency, and delivering a trusted experience to customers and partners worldwide and we are looking for a passionate Senior Technical Program Manager to help achieve that mission. Responsibilities Owning/executing critical hardware remediations along the end-to-end hardware manufacturing spectrum working with stakeholders from supply chain, DC operations, capacity management and engineering groups. Ability to influence partners, make key decisions pertaining to hardware quality escapes and develop a systematic mitigation plan to resolve quality issues. Identifying opportunities and tools that allow a reduction of manual work and automate process workflows including prior work with agentic AI. Ability to perform cost/time/risk tradeoff analysis while being customer centric and budget conscious. Partner with leadership and teams to create an inclusive environment that attracts and retains engineers. Conduct in-depth data analysis to help derive insights and drive business decisions. Qualifications Required: Doctorate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Materials Engineering, Reliability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or related field AND 2+ years technical engineering experience OR Master's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Materials Engineering, Reliability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or related field AND 4+ years technical engineering experience OR Bachelor's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Materials Engineering, Reliability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or related field AND 5+ years technical engineering experience OR 12+ years relevant technical engineering experience. Ability to meet Microsoft, customer and/or government security screening requirements are required for this role. These requirements include,but are not limited to the following specialized security screenings: Microsoft Cloud Background Check: This position will be required to pass the Microsoft Cloud Background Check upon hire/transfer and every two years thereafter. Preferred: 7 - 10+ years in the server hardware industry. Working knowledge of disciplines across data center and server/rack hardware quality. Ability to work on issues that span geos and provide clear/aligned communication to stakeholders. Ability to write/run Kusto/SQL queries. Knowledge of Power BI. Experience working in the end-to-end server hardware quality space from system integrators to data center operations.
